Web8 mei 2024 · In case you're not familiar, let's first review the fundamentals of computer storage. A bit is the smallest amount of data a computer can store. Since computers use the binary numbering system, each bit can be either a 0 or a 1.To put this in perspective, one bit is enough to store whether a value is true or false. Web6 jul. 2024 · 4GB: 2 days, 32 minutes. 8GB: 4 days, 1 hour, 5 minutes. A good rule of thumb to remember is that 60 minutes of 2 track 24-bit 48 kHz BWAV audio requires about 1 GB of storage. From there, you can easily add or subtract how much storage you need when using the same sample rate. If recording a single track of audio, your storage will double. Web8 jan. 2024 · With one subscription, you can share your 200GB of storage with up to five other family members. This means a total of six people share your 200GB of iCloud storage. Each family member’s storage is private, though. So you won’t be able to see other people’s files or pictures, and they can't see yours either. WebPhoto Storage: Amazon Prime members get free, unlimited, full-resolution photo storage, plus 5 GB video storage. All other customers get 5 GB photo and video storage.
